Frequently Asked Questions

My soil seems compacted and nothing grows well. Is this just old age?

Your property's 1978 construction date means the soil is about 48 years old, but its maturity is low. Original grading typically stripped topsoil, leaving the underlying Alkaline Sandy Loam (pH 7.5-8.2) common in Lakeside Heights. Decades of foot traffic and standard irrigation have compacted it further, reducing permeability and microbial life. Core aeration and incorporating 2-3 inches of composted organic matter are critical first steps to rebuild structure and buffer the high pH for healthier plant growth.

How can I keep my St. Augustine grass green under Stage 2 water restrictions?

Maintaining turf under voluntary conservation requires precision. A Smart Wi-Fi ET-based controller is essential; it adjusts schedules daily using local evapotranspiration data, applying water only as needed. For St. Augustine or Hybrid Bermuda in Zone 10a, we program for deep, infrequent watering in the early morning to minimize evaporation and fungal pressure. This method typically reduces usage by 20-30% while preserving canopy health, keeping you well within municipal limits.

What permits and licenses are needed to regrade and landscape my 0.35-acre lot?

Any significant grading, drainage alteration, or retaining wall construction over 18 inches on a 0.35-acre lot requires a permit from the County of San Diego Planning & Development Services. The contractor must hold a valid C-27 California Contractors State License Board (CSLB) license for landscaping. This ensures they are bonded, insured, and understand local codes, including the Watershed Protection Ordinance. Never hire an unlicensed individual for this work, as it risks fines and unstable, non-compliant results.

Is Decomposed Granite a good choice for patios and paths, or should I use wood?

In an Extreme Fire Wise rated WUI zone, material choice is critical for defensible space. Decomposed Granite is a superior, non-combustible option compared to wood. When stabilized and bordered with concrete, it provides a durable, permeable surface that suppresses weed growth and requires zero maintenance. It also radiates less heat than concrete pavers. This makes DG an ideal, code-compliant hardscape that enhances both safety and functionality in high-risk areas.

I'm tired of constant mowing and blowing. Are there quieter, lower-maintenance options?

Absolutely. Transitioning to a climate-adaptive landscape with natives like Cleveland Sage, California Buckwheat, and Deergrass eliminates weekly mowing and gas-powered leaf blowing. These plants thrive in Zone 10a with minimal summer water once established and provide superior habitat. This shift future-proofs your property against tightening noise ordinances and reduces your carbon footprint. The resulting landscape requires only seasonal pruning with quiet electric tools.

My yard floods and erodes after heavy rain. What's a permanent solution?

Flash flood potential in canyon-adjacent areas like yours is a serious hazard with Alkaline Sandy Loam, which can crust and shed water. The solution is improving infiltration and managing sheet flow. We install French drains tied to dry wells and regrade to direct water away from foundations. Using permeable materials like Decomposed Granite for paths meets County of San Diego Planning & Development Services runoff standards by allowing percolation, reducing erosion and downstream siltation.

My lawn has strange patches. Could it be an invasive pest or disease?

Invasive species like Bermudagrass incursion into St. Augustine or outbreaks of fungal pathogens like Take-All Root Rot are common alerts here. Accurate diagnosis is key, as treatment timing is regulated. Any remedy must comply with the San Diego County Watershed Protection Ordinance, which prohibits nitrogen/phosphorus runoff. We use targeted, organic fungicides or manual extraction methods only during approved application windows, ensuring plant health without contaminating local waterways.
